你有没有想过,安卓游戏里的那些精彩瞬间,其实都是背后有一群程序员在默默码代码呢?没错,就是那些让人眼花缭乱的特效、刺激的战斗场景,还有那些让人欲罢不能的关卡设计,全都是靠这些代码一点一滴构建起来的。那么,安卓游戏代码究竟藏在哪里呢?今天,就让我带你一探究竟吧!
首先,你得知道,安卓游戏代码的“家”在哪里。没错,就是那个全球最大的开源代码托管平台——GitHub。在这里,你可以找到几乎所有的安卓游戏源代码,无论是热门的《王者荣耀》,还是小众的独立游戏,都能在这里找到它们的身影。
GitHub上的安卓游戏代码,通常都是以开源协议发布的,这意味着你可以自由地查看、学习、修改甚至分发这些代码。不过,要注意的是,有些游戏可能因为商业原因,代码并不是完全开源的,这时候就需要你具备一定的搜索技巧,才能找到那些隐藏的宝藏。
那么,如何在GitHub上找到你想要的安卓游戏代码呢?这里有几个小技巧,让你轻松成为代码搜索达人:
1. 关键词搜索:在GitHub的搜索框中输入游戏名称或者相关关键词,比如“安卓游戏源代码”、“游戏开发”等,就能找到相关的项目。
2. 项目:很多开源项目都会在GitHub上添加(Tags),你可以通过来筛选你感兴趣的游戏类型或者开发语言。
3. 关注热门项目:GitHub上有很多热门的开源游戏项目,比如《Minecraft》、《Cocos2d-x》等,关注这些项目,可以第一时间了解到最新的游戏开发动态。
找到了心仪的游戏代码,接下来就是深入探索它的奥秘了。这里有几个步骤,帮助你更好地理解安卓游戏代码:
1. 阅读README文件:每个开源项目都会有一个README文件,里面包含了项目的简介、安装方法、使用说明等,这是了解项目的基础。
2. 查看代码结构:通过查看项目的目录结构,你可以了解到游戏的主要模块和功能。
3. 分析关键代码:针对游戏中的关键功能,比如游戏逻辑、界面设计、音效处理等,深入分析其代码实现。
4. 学习开发技巧:在阅读代码的过程中,你会发现很多优秀的开发技巧,这些都是你值得学习的。
光看代码是不够的,动手实践才是提升技能的关键。以下是一些建议:
1. 搭建开发环境:根据项目要求,搭建相应的开发环境,比如Android Studio、Cocos2d-x等。
2. 修改代码:尝试修改代码,比如调整游戏难度、添加新功能等,这样可以加深你对代码的理解。
3. 编写自己的游戏:结合所学知识,尝试编写自己的安卓游戏,这样可以将所学知识融会贯通。
4. 参与开源项目:加入开源项目,与其他开发者一起合作,共同完善游戏。
安卓游戏代码就在那里,等着你去探索、去学习、去实践。只要你有兴趣,有毅力,相信你一定能成为一名优秀的安卓游戏开发者!